Dark matter in theories of gauge-mediated supersymmetry breaking

S. Dimopoulos, G.F. Giudice, A. Pomarol
1996 Physics Letters B  
In gauge-mediated theories supersymmetry breaking originates in a strongly interacting sector and is communicated to the ordinary sparticles via SU(3)×SU(2)×U(1) carrying "messenger" particles. Stable baryons of the strongly interacting supersymmetry breaking sector naturally weigh ∼ 100 TeV and are viable cold dark matter candidates.
